Wednesday, May 14 • 11:00am - 11:40am
Complex query on Ceilometer stats & project-specific meters

Complex query support for statistics:

The rich query functionality, implemented by the Complex filter expressions in API queries blueprint, is available for Samples, Alarms and Alarm History, however this functionality is applicable for Statistics as well. The current implementation supports selectable parametrized aggregate functions (e.g. cardinality) with at most a single parameter per function. The idea is to provide the possibility of using the complex query functionality for Statistics and use the flexibility of the JSON representation of the request body for supporting the definition of multiple parameters for a selectable aggregate. This extension will also support all the functions that are available via the /meters endpoint with simple query.

The goal of this session is to discuss the API design and the supported features in a statistics request.

(Session proposed by Ildiko Vancsa)

Project-based data collection configuration:

Ceilometer now supports only a global configuration for pipelines, which means that the parameters set for meters are applicable for all projects/tenants. There would be several advantages of provide the possibility to configure the data collection mechanism for projects/tenants, like storing as much data as necessary and also to make Ceilometer more flexible related to the customer needs.

Currently only the virtual resources are aware of the corresponding project, therefore this configuration improvement will be implemented first for the meters of virtual resources. The next step would be to extend the functionality also to the physical/project-less resources.

(Session proposed by Ildiko Vancsa)

